
The addition of Bärbel Strauß, who today joined global real advisor Cushman & Wakefield in
Germany as Partner and Co-Head of Valuation & Advisory, completes the planned tripartite
leadership team of the valuation department. The new Partner will take on the task of
establishing, building and leading a residential real estate valuation team based in Berlin.
Strauß has concentrated on the valuation of large residential portfolios in recent years and
led a residential valuation team at CBRE in Berlin. Prior to joining CBRE in 2005 she was a
freelance consultant, among other topics, on real estate.
Cushman & Wakefield is planning to double the size of its currently 20-strong valuation
team in Frankfurt and Berlin over the next two-to-three years and is seeking experienced
managers as well as young talent. The firm is additionally making significant investment in
technology and processes, to further increase efficiency and be able to offer clients even
faster response times. In addition to being a Chartered Surveyor and a highly-experienced
valuer, Bärbel Strauß also brings particular expertise in this area; in the implementation of
IT tools, databanks and applications.
